Q: Is 258,460,456 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 258,460,456 is not a prime number.

Why is 258,460,456 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 258460456 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 32,307,557 64,615,114 129,230,228 and 258,460,456, with no remainder.

Since 258,460,456 cannot be divided by just 1 and 258,460,456, it is not a prime number.
